Hey guys I've got a bit of a wierd one for you, I recently ordered some new vallejo paints from wayland and I got all of my colours delivered correctly other than one, the colour I had ordered was model air dark sea blue but the colour I received was steel blue. Now I did a bit of searching around to see if they are the same paint just re packaged, but I couldn't find it anywhere as being listed by wayland or by vallejo the,selves
